Idaho Rivers United/Nez Perce Federal Court Hearing @ James McClure Federal Building
Sep 9 @ 11:00 pm – Sep 10 @ 12:30 am

FROM WIRT: In solidarity with Nez Perce megaload blockaders, carpools are departing the WIRT Activist House at 8 am on Monday, September 9, with stops through the reservation, to rally outside and pack the 4 pm Boise federal court hearing seeking a megaload injunction. Advocates for the West will present oral arguments for suspending Idaho Transportation Department permits for Highway 12 megaloads until the Forest Service completes its megaload impact study. After the Nez Perce Tribe and Idaho Rivers United (IRU) versus the U.S. Forest Service case hearing, IRU is hosting a gathering of anti-megaload activists that evening, before we return to north central Idaho. Sustainability Center Hosting Student Panel on Food Security @ University of Idaho Commons, Crest Room, 4th Floor
Apr 17 @ 6:00 pm – 8:00 pm

WHAT:          The University of Idaho Sustainability Center is hosting an interdisciplinary, student-led panel discussion on the future of food entitled, “Feeding the Future”.

DETAILS:     Students from International Studies, Agricultural Economics, Bioregional Planning, and Business will discuss complex food systems issues in a panel discussion hosted and moderated by the University of Idaho Sustainability Center. Topics will range from the value of sustainable agriculture practices to finding the balance between using acreage for biofuels versus food production. Audience members will have the opportunity to participate in the discussion with questions, and pizza will be provided for attendees. The diverse viewpoints and backgrounds of the student panelists will provide an opportunity to learn about the importance of finding collaborative solutions to global food issues.

Walter Echo-Hawk Visiting University of Idaho @ Menard Law Building, Courtroom
Sep 18 @ 10:00 pm – 11:30 pm

Walter Echo-Hawk (Pawnee Tribe) is a Native American attorney, speaker, activist and author. He will be discussing his new book, “In the Light of Justice: The Rise of Human Rights in Native America and the UN Declaration on the Rights of Indigenous Peoples.”
